Essential Job Duties:
- Performs design analysis
- Assists team in developing engineering designs, packaging arrangements & loading arrangements
- Assists in implementing engineering changes
- Develops PFEP (Plan For Every Part/Package) documentation and packaging
- Participates in solution of engineering related product problems (Root Cause) especially regarding handling damage issues
- Works with engineering functions, suppliers, plant personnel and others to implement cost reduction, standardization, methods improvement, and product improvements
- Run projects as needed.
- Plans and implements test and / or development programs regarding new packaging
- Releases packaging parts for production
- Communicates information to and from internal and external customer organizations
- Coordinates and consults with departments outside engineering such as Manufacturing, Purchasing and Quality
- Stays abreast of new technology and competitive products
- Provide processing support for operations including spec development, problem solving, material ordering,
- Spec and support packaging equipment.
- Investigate freight and warehouse damage or packaging discrepancies.
